WebDec 17, 2024 · Calcareous sand is a deposit formed by the remains of marine organisms (such as corals, algae, and shells) after being repeatedly washed and broken by seawater. WebDec 1, 2024 · Calcareous sediments are mainly precipitated by weathering of highly carbonate rocks and/or biological processes by marine organisms. Poulos [1] pointed out that the particle size of calcareous sediments varies from sand to clay sizes, although most are sand to silt sized.
